Description

Fatty Acids, C18-Unsatd., Dimers, Polymers With Azelaic Acid And Ethylenediamine is a high-performance polymeric amide derived from unsaturated C18 fatty acid dimers, azelaic acid, and ethylenediamine. This specialized chemical is engineered to provide exceptional performance as a rheology modifier, dispersing agent, and film-forming component in demanding industrial formulations. It is a critical raw material for manufacturers in the coatings, adhesives, and lubricant industries seeking to enhance product durability, stability, and application properties.

Application

  • Coatings & Inks: Acts as a rheology modifier and anti-settling agent in solvent-based and high-solids coatings, improving sag resistance and pigment dispersion.
  • Adhesives & Sealants: Used as a tackifier and reinforcing agent to improve cohesive strength, thermal stability, and adhesion to various substrates.
  • Lubricants & Greases: Functions as a thickener and performance additive, enhancing the structural stability and load-bearing capacity of complex greases.
  • Polymer Additives: Serves as a compatibilizer and processing aid in polymer blends and composites.
  • Corrosion Inhibitors: Utilized in formulating protective coatings and additives due to its film-forming and barrier properties.
  • Printing Applications: Enhances the viscosity and transfer characteristics of printing inks and pastes.

Basic Information

Item Details
Product Name Fatty Acids, C18-Unsatd., Dimers, Polymers With Azelaic Acid And Ethylenediamine
CAS No. 68139-68-4
Molecular Formula Complex polymeric mixture
Molecular Weight Variable (Polymeric)
Synonyms Polyamide resin from dimerized fatty acid and azelaic acid; Dimer acid-azelaic acid-ethylenediamine polyamide; Ethylenediamine polymer with azelaic acid and dimer acid; C18 unsaturated fatty acid dimer polyamide; Azelaic acid-dimer acid copolymer with ethylenediamine; Polymeric fatty acid amide; Versamid-type polyamide (generic); Dimer acid polyamide resin

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). Keep away from strong bases and incompatible materials such as strong oxidizing agents. The product has a typical shelf life of 24 months when stored under these recommended conditions.
